What we do

Custom tooling & mould development
We design and manufacture moulds to match your product requirements and production volumes: fabricated steel, cast aluminium and high-precision CNC aluminium options. Our tooling service includes mould design, trial runs, adjustments and ongoing mould maintenance.

Production runs
We handle one-off builds, low- to medium-volume runs and larger orders. Rotational moulding is ideal for projects where tooling costs must be balanced against per-part cost — typical throughput is suitable for bespoke or mid-volume programmes. We can scale capacity depending on tooling and part complexity.

Secondary operations & finishing
We provide a full suite of post-mould services to deliver finished products:

  • CNC trimming, drilling and routing
  • Assembly and mechanical fittings (hinges, locks, latches, mounts)
  • Printing, labelling and pad printing for branding or safety marking
  • Lacquering and surface finishes (textured, gloss, matt)
  • Foam filling, double-wall options and bonded inserts for strength or insulation

Material & performance options
We mould in LLDPE, HDPE, PP and a range of specialised compounds (UV-stabilised grades, chemical-resistant, flame-retardant and anti-microbial materials). We’ll recommend the right material and construction for durability, UV performance and the intended use environment.

Quality assurance & reliability

We apply strict process controls at every stage — material verification, precise charge weights, controlled heating/cooling cycles and a final inspection routine. Experienced technicians monitor moulding parameters to reduce variation and ensure consistent wall thickness and part strength.

 

Helpful notes

  • Tooling choices: Steel = cost-effective for simple shapes; Cast aluminium = better wall consistency and medium detail; CNC aluminium = highest precision for complex or tight-tolerance parts. (Learn more about mould types and materials.)
